## Step 2: Flip on the contrast checker

Next up in the Glowvale audit migration — enable the new color-contrast linter so support can see flagged screens before customers do. It runs against every themed view and logs anything under the required ratio. Don't panic at the first report; legacy themes will fail plenty. To turn it on, apply the following settings to the audit service.

service settings:
PRAIX_LOG_LEVEL=error
PRAIX_METRICS_HOST=metrics.praix.qorvelcorp.corp
PRAIX_POOL_SIZE=16

## Audit Checklist — Item 12: Monthly Table Partitioning

Verify that the Ledgerbrook reporting tables are partitioned by calendar month and that partitions older than 24 months are archived, not dropped. New team members: check that the partition-creation job ran for the upcoming month and that no rows landed in the default partition. Record findings in the audit sheet. Any discrepancy must be reported directly to the owner named below.

account owner for bawip-tahag: Raleth Quenok

Subject: On-call handover — stale-cache postmortem

Handing off Driftline on-call. Postmortem draft for the stale-cache bug is in the incident folder; action items assigned, two still unowned. Cache TTL fix shipped Tuesday, monitoring looks clean. Please present the summary at the weekly sync. Questions on the timeline go to the address below.

alerts address for kajog-tadup: druox@plorvanet.internal

## Tuning

Oldenquist's audit-log viewer paginates queries against the cold store, so most latency complaints trace back to page size and prefetch depth rather than the index itself. For the sync: we recommend adjusting prefetch first, then the result cache TTL, and only touching the scan parallelism if the Marrowgate replica is underloaded. Defaults that have held up in production are shown below.

constants for fafof-yadug:
QUOTAS = {
    "gorael": 575,
    "kasok": 31,
}